COLUMBIA, Miss. (WDAM) - Breast cancer affects almost 240,000 women every year in the United States. Of the thousands who reach the most advanced stage, less than 30 percent survive. In July 2015, at age 33, Nicole Matis was diagnosed with Stage 4 breast cancer. Matis says she discovered a lump on her right breast and decided to go see a doctor. “They called me on that Tuesday and they were like, ‘We are so sorry, Mrs. Matis. You have a 2.6-centimeter tumor.
